TRUE/FALSE. (18.01.2026)recode(): Removed new_var parameter.
Recode now doesn’t return the whole data frame anymore, but only the
recoded variable as a vector. So instead of writing
my_data <- my_data |> recode("age_group", age = age.),
the syntax is now more natural like this
my_data[["age_group"]] <- my_data |> recode(age = age.).
(21.01.2026)running_number(), mark_case(),
retain_value(), retain_sum(): Removed
var_name parameter. Functions now don’t return the whole
data frame anymore, but only the retained variable as a vector or list
of vectors. So instead of writing
e.g. my_data <- my_data |> running_number("running"),
the syntax is now more natural like this
my_data[["running"]] <- my_data |> running_number().

specific way and a number. (05.02.2026)summarise_plus(): When only statistics based on sums
are selected, the function already pre summarises the data frame, to
apply the formats on a much smaller data frame. When using nesting =
“all”/“single” the data frame is now pre summarised a second time before
applying formats, this time only using the grouping variables of the
combination beeing processed. This drastically cuts down memory
allocation - especially for larger data frames - and speeds up every
iteration significantly. In addition to this function
any_table() benefits greatly from this optimization.
(16.01.2026)any_table(), frequencies(),
